Interpretation
Interpretation is giving meaning to facts, signals or events based on context, beliefs and experience.
Definition
Interpretation is not the same as fact. The same stimulus can be interpreted as a threat, an opportunity, a slight or a neutral situation. Interpretive awareness helps you recognize cognitive distortions, test alternative explanations, and respond more appropriately.

Practice and life
In a difficult situation, write down: a fact, my first interpretation, three other possible interpretations and data for each of them.
Common misunderstanding
It is a mistake to treat the first interpretation as reality. A common mistake is to only look for data that confirms the initial meaning.
